I hate to "spoil the party" but most played does not equal best. Case in point ISS vanguard. I played it (the full gameplay of the core campaign). I was playing with great satisfaction until a determined scenario that completely blew it for me and it just revealed to me that no matter what your gameplay is, the story will move forward. I get it that you are the captain of the ISS Vanguard, but I felt that the people that made my "crew" were important, until the game/story just started treating them as cannon fodder, because "who care if this guy dies, just to get me a nice option later on". The second half of the game was terribly disappointing for me leaving me with the feeling that I just had to finish it up and sell it quickly because I was starting to get nauseous just reading it. For me the gameplay is fun (except for the "combat" which is awful), and they should have made it more about the exploration, than anything else.
